Grundig Business Systems and Verdatum solve dictation hardware issues for Rutan & Tucker LLP
As the Digta SonicMic, along with all other GBS dictation hardware, is fully integrated with the Verdatum platform, the pilot rollout was straightforward as device driver support was remotely pushed out by the Verdatum system. Within several days of the pilot launch, Rutan’s users found the ergonomic design of the Digta SonicMic appealing, and Rutan´s IT support found the hardware to meet their stability and reliability requirements.
As a result of the pilot program, Rutan has removed all competitive products and replaced them with over 60 GBS Digta SonicMics. The combination of the GBS Digta SonicMics and the Verdatum workflow system has produced a stable dictation platform on the Vista Enterprise OS, serving the needs of both day to day end users as well as IT administration.

About Verdatum
Verdatum, the 2008 Law Technology News Gold Award Winner for dictation systems, produces digital dictation systems designed to replace analog (tape based) dictation so that dictation may be tracked and managed on the network just as documents are. Verdatum solutions either tightly integrate with the law firm’s document management system or operate as a stand-alone solution with the integrated document tracking system. The company is headquartered in New York, NY and serves law firms in the US and Canada. Its management has over 50 years combined experience in legal practice, law firm management, and legal IT administration. The company counts as customers law firms ranging in size from 10 attorneys to over 600. To learn more, visit the company´s website at www.verdatumsys.com.

Grundig Business Systems, 1450, Inc. and Smoltz Distributing, Inc. Announce Alliance
March 17, 2009, Naperville, IL, Palm Beach Gardens, FL and Cave Creek, AZ – On March 17, 2009, Grundig Business Systems (GBS), one of the world’s leading suppliers of professional dictation systems, and 1450, Inc. announced a strategic alliance for distribution and support of GBS digital dictation solutions. 1450 is the largest Dragon NaturallySpeaking and speech recognition value added distributor. With the new alliance, the 1450 reseller channel will have access to the GBS lineup of digital dictation portable recorders, as well as GBS’s professional desktop dictation microphones, including the Digta CordEx, the only wireless, professional dictation microphone available within the voice processing industry. Smoltz Distributing Inc., GBS’s exclusive United States distribution partner, will provide the product supply and support for this partnership.

Designed for professional users with a high dictation volume, Grundig Business Systems’ product range includes devices for mobile and desktop dictations. Optional plug-in modules such as barcode readers and RFID scanners help to automate and optimize dictation processes. The DigtaSoft software range allows for secure and efficient dictation and workflow management, helps control standalone desktop solutions as well as local and international network areas, and is easily integrated into existing IT infrastructures.

About Smoltz Distributing Inc.
Smoltz Distributing Inc. are dedicated specialists in digital and analog dictation and transcription products and accessories. The Smoltz team prides itself on always providing dealers with full service and support. John Smoltz has been in the business since 1970. Along with his wife Mary, John opened Smoltz Distributing Inc. in 1995. Based in Warren, Michigan, with warehouses in Michigan, Georgia and Arizona, the Smoltz team remains rooted in "family-owned and operated" values with a complete commitment to the service and support of its network of over 400 authorized dealers. Grundig Business Systems takes design honours for second year

The DigtaSonic Mic is designed for professional users of desktop dictation. The wide, ergonomic slide switch makes for effortless dictation, with a more positive slide action bringing more precision. “Mouse Control” gives the user control of his PC software without needing a PC mouse - file processing is controlled via Track-Point instead. The device also supports the DSSPro language standard, providing optimum recording and playback quality.
Dictation gets colourful with limited edition from Grundig Business Systems

London, March 2008 – Grundig Business Systems GmbH, one of the world's leading manufacturers of professional dictation systems, has announced the launch of a Limited Edition Digta 415 digital dictation device. The new edition brings a splash of colour to the office, with its floral pattern and sunny, yellow/ orange casing; it is hoped that the special edition will appeal particularly to female users.
There are only 200 Digta 415 Limited Edition devices available and each one costs the same as the regular Digta 415 - £255 (RRP Ex VAT),
